Understanding the Unique Traits of African Grey Parrots
African Grey parrots are widely regarded as one of the most intelligent bird species, showcasing remarkable cognitive abilities. Their capacity for mimicry is unmatched, and they can often imitate human speech with astonishing clarity. This ability stems from their social nature, as they thrive on interaction and communication. In addition to their vocal talents, African Greys exhibit complex emotional behaviors, which require owners to engage with them regularly to foster a strong bond.

What kind of diet do African Greys require?
A balanced diet should include high-quality pellets, fresh fruits, and vegetables. Consult with an avian vet to tailor the diet to your bird's specific needs.

Understanding the Commitment
Owning an African Grey parrot is a long-term commitment that can last 40 years or more. It’s essential to consider your lifestyle and whether you can provide the necessary attention and care throughout their life. These birds thrive on companionship, and neglect can lead to behavioral issues, which can be challenging to manage.

How much does it cost to care for an African Grey parrot?
The initial purchase price can range from $1,500 to $3,000, with ongoing costs for food, toys, and veterinary care adding significant expenses.

Training Your African Grey Parrot
Training is an essential aspect of owning an African Grey parrot. These birds are highly intelligent and can learn various behaviors, commands, and tricks. Start with basic commands such as "step up" and "come here." Positive reinforcement techniques, such as offering treats or praise, can encourage desired behaviors. Patience and consistency are key in training your parrot, as it may take time for them to learn new skills.

How much time do I need to dedicate to an African Grey?

Finding Trustworthy Sources for African Grey Parrots
When searching for African Grey parrots for sale, finding a reputable seller is paramount. This ensures that you are acquiring a bird that has been raised ethically and is in good health. Start by researching local avian breeders, rescue organizations, or reputable pet stores that specialize in birds. Always check for reviews and recommendations from other bird owners to gauge the credibility of the source.

Is it better to buy or adopt an African Grey parrot?
Both options have their merits; purchasing from a reputable breeder ensures a healthy bird, while adopting can give a loving home to a parrot in need.
